The Youngs wanted to make their small master bathroom—only four-by-ten feet—feel larger. And since it featured outdated black-and-white tiled floors, walls and shower, old painted cabinets and fixtures well past their prime, they felt it was high time for some upgrades.
|
Custom cabinets on either side of the toilet added storage space to the small room. New finishes and fixtures throughout brought things up to date. Marble countertops, glass vessel sink and glass waterfall faucet. Custom-curved functioning vanity with opening doors. New toilet. New tiled shower with glass tile accents. And it’s all finished off with softer, neutral modern colors and styling. There’s still not a lot of space, but what’s done with it makes all the difference.
